I was wondering something about the Champions League qualifying. What if you have Montreal winning the Canadian Cup and then Toronto or Vancouver winning the MLS Cup? Does that mean 2 Canadian teams get to go?
Posted on 8/8/13 at 12:33 am to itawambadog
Nevermind I found the answer. Basically only the winner of the Canadian Cup can go according to wikipedia. A club from Canada could win the Supporters Shield or go to the MLS final and not qualify. In that case that spot would to the American team with the best record that's not already in the Champions League.
